Product Search
Categories
Information
Page 4 / 6
« | 1 2 3 4 5 6 | »
Products per page: 21 51 102
Sort by   Salutation   Price

Grand Pianos (123)

Grand Pianos
Page 4 / 6
« | 1 2 3 4 5 6 | »
Products per page: 21 51 102
Sort by   Salutation   Price